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Palmer

** The Mazda repair market in Palmer itself is characterized by a few high-quality, independent auto repair shops rather than brand-specific specialists. The average quality of these top independents is very high, as evidenced by their stellar reviews and long-term community presence. Competition is moderate, with a focus on building trust and retaining long-term customers rather than undercutting prices. For routine maintenance on common Mazda models (e.g., CX-5, Mazda3), the local independents like F & F Motors and Gary's Auto Repair are excellent, cost-effective choices. However, for highly specialized work—particularly involving rotary engines (RX-series), which is an extremely rare specialty, or complex warranty/recall work—residents typically travel to the authorized dealership, Gary Rome Mazda in Holyoke (a ~20-minute drive). Pricing follows this structure: Independents offer more competitive labor rates, while the dealership commands a premium for OEM parts, certified expertise, and brand-backed service. For a standard oil change on a Skyactiv engine, expect to pay ~$60-80 at an independent and ~$80-110 at the dealer. For complex diagnostics, the dealer's specialized tools can sometimes lead to a faster and more accurate resolution, justifying the higher cost.

What are the most common Mazda repair issues for drivers in the Palmer, MA area?

In Palmer, common issues include suspension wear from our local roads with seasonal potholes, as well as brake corrosion from winter road salt. Certain Mazda models, like the CX-5, may also require attention for infotainment system glitches or minor oil leaks, which local specialists are very familiar with.

How can I find a trustworthy, independent shop for Mazda repair near Palmer?

Look for a shop in the Palmer/Ware area that employs ASE-certified technicians and specifically advertises experience with Mazda or Japanese imports. Checking for positive online reviews from local customers and asking if they use genuine or high-quality aftermarket Mazda parts are excellent indicators of a quality shop.

Are Mazda repair costs generally higher at the dealership versus a local Palmer shop?

Yes, you will typically find lower labor rates at a reputable independent shop in Palmer or the surrounding towns compared to a distant dealership. However, always request a detailed written estimate to compare, as parts pricing and the scope of the repair can vary.

When should I seek service for my Mazda's check engine light around Palmer?

Seek service immediately if the light is flashing or if you notice a loss of power, as this could indicate a serious issue. For a steady light, you can visit a local Palmer shop for a diagnostic scan, which is crucial as our colder climate and stop-and-go traffic on routes like 20 or 32 can trigger specific emissions and sensor codes.

What local factors in Palmer should influence my Mazda's maintenance schedule?

Palmer's distinct seasons demand specific attention. Prioritize undercarriage washes to combat winter salt corrosion and more frequent brake inspections due to hilly terrain. Following the "severe service" schedule in your manual is advisable because of our temperature extremes and the mix of short trips and highway driving on I-90.
